SVI BREMCO, is expanding its gas turbine exhaust solutions designed to address operational challenges at power generation facilities across the United States.
The company has engineered gas turbine silencer systems that utilize Computational Fluid Dynamics (CFD) modeling to analyze aerodynamics throughout exhaust systems, addressing flow distribution issues that improve performance in Simple Cycle exhaust systems as well as Combined Cycle systems with Heat Recovery Steam Generators (HRSG).
A recent project at a combined-cycle power plant demonstrated the application of these technologies when the facility required replacement of an egg-crate style turning vane set in their HRSG unit. The engineering team conducted CFD analysis to evaluate flow distribution. As a result, SVI BREMCO developed a new deflector plate with an open area as the solution.

Founded in 1993 and headquartered in Pineville, North Carolina, SVI BREMCO provides industrial plant maintenance solutions for power generation and industrial facilities. Comprising three divisions—SVI Industrial, SVI Dynamics, and BREMCO—this privately held company employs between 51 and 200 professionals specializing in industrial contracting, mechanical services, gas path solutions(TM), and industrial masonry services.
